Abstract
The utility model provides a driving circuit of an LED light source. The driving circuit comprises a rectification filter circuit, a forward switch power circuit connected with the rectification filter circuit, a high frequency transformer and a DC output circuit connected with a secondary side of the high frequency transformer. The driving circuit is characterized in that the DC output end of the DC output circuit is connected with an LED circuit and a current-limiting voltage-limiting monitoring circuit; and the control output end of the current-limiting voltage-limiting monitoring circuit is connected with the control input end of the forward switch power circuit. By adopting the current-limiting voltage-limiting monitoring circuit for controlling the forward switch power circuit, the output voltage of the DC output circuit is controlled, and the power supply for the LED in the constant current mode can be realized.

Embodiment
(embodiment 1)
See Fig. 1-2, the drive circuit of the led light source of present embodiment comprises: filter rectifier 1, the positive activation type switching power circuit 3 that links to each other with filter rectifier 1, high frequency transformer 5 and with the secondary dc output circuit that links to each other 6 of high frequency transformer 5, it is characterized in that: the dc output end of dc output circuit 6 is connected with led circuit 2 and current limiting pressure-limiting supervisory circuit 7, and the control output end of current limiting pressure-limiting supervisory circuit 7 links to each other with the control input end of positive activation type switching power circuit 3.
Described positive activation type switching power circuit 3 comprises switching tube Q2 and the oscillation control circuit that is used for by pwm signal driving switch pipe Q2; The control input end of described positive activation type switching power circuit 3 is the control input end of oscillation control circuit.
The control output end of described current limiting pressure-limiting supervisory circuit 7 links to each other with the control input end of oscillation control circuit through photoelectrical coupler IC2.
Described current limiting pressure-limiting supervisory circuit 7 comprises: first comparator circuit that is used for the pressure limiting monitoring that links to each other with dc output circuit 6 and second comparator circuit that is used for the current limliting monitoring that links to each other with dc output circuit 6; The output of first comparator circuit and second comparator circuit links to each other with light-emitting diode among the described photoelectrical coupler IC2.
First comparator circuit comprises: the voltage-stabiliser tube series circuit, amplifier IC3A and the peripheral circuit thereof that are made of voltage-stabiliser tube DZ1, DZ2 and DZ25.Second comparator circuit comprises amplifier IC3B and peripheral circuit thereof.Oscillation control circuit comprises: vibration control chip IC1 (model of employing is 3843) and peripheral circuit thereof.Coil N3 is self-oscillatory positive feedback coil, and it links to each other by the positive feedback input of drive circuit with vibration control chip IC1.
